filemanager/src/filemanager/src/components/fmviewdetailsdialog.h
changeset 16 ada7962b4308
parent 14 1957042d8c7e
child 18 edd66bde63a4
child 25 b7bfdea70ca2
--- a/filemanager/src/filemanager/src/components/fmviewdetailsdialog.h	Fri Apr 16 14:53:38 2010 +0300
+++ b/filemanager/src/filemanager/src/components/fmviewdetailsdialog.h	Mon May 03 12:24:39 2010 +0300
@@ -73,11 +73,12 @@
     virtual ~FmViewDetailsDialog();
     
     static void showDriveViewDetailsDialog( const QString &driverName, 
-                                            QList<FmDriveDetailsSize*> detailsSizeList );
+                                            QList<FmDriveDetailsSize*> detailsSizeList,
+											const QString& associatedDrives = QString() );
     static void showFolderViewDetailsDialog( const QString &folderPath,
                                              int numofSubFolders, int numofFiles, 
-                                             quint64 sizeofFolder);
-    static void showFileViewDetailsDialog( const QString &filePath );
+                                             quint64 sizeofFolder, const QString& associatedDrives = QString() );
+    static void showFileViewDetailsDialog( const QString &filePath, const QString& associatedDrives = QString() );
     
 private:
     FmViewDetailsDialog( QGraphicsItem *parent = 0 );
@@ -89,6 +90,7 @@
     void setNumofSubfolders( int numofSubFolders, int numofFiles, quint64 sizeofFolder );
     void setSizeofContent( QList<FmDriveDetailsSize*> detailsSizeList );
     
+	static HbAction *executeDialog( HbDialog *dialog, const QString &associatedDrives );
 private:
     HbListView *mListView;
     HbLabel *mHeaderLabel;